Output 118ef96042b42b3420e3b147403fda77cbaf6dd660b477cf8a6852c0ef97e8e9:8

value
30880115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87da521b9553861aa3085ac2a79244eb7acc6363 OP_EQUAL
address
MLHUzWz5aCHv9XhMtDsShXxd8r1MctPrhX
transaction
118ef96042b42b3420e3b147403fda77cbaf6dd660b477cf8a6852c0ef97e8e9
spent
true